Bio

Hend Saqawa was born and raised in Egypt. She is currently working toward a Bachelor of Medicine and Surgery at Sohag University. Hend is a member of Gheith Blood Donation and Health Awareness Team at Sohag University, volunteer Math Teacher at Resala, and Co-founder of Ahl-Allah team.

What ignited your pursuit for gender equality?

Seeing women in my community starting to believe that you are born less than men and accepting our current situation is what opened my eyes and held me responsible for opening their eyes to the truth as well.

Please share your biggest wins as an advocate for gender equality.

I made a decision to start giving the fifth grade class that I teach additional discussions in class about empowering women and self-love. One of my girls told me that she stood before her teacher at school, and when he told them that girls could not do math, she told him that girls could do anything. In a community like this, seeing them raising their voices is the win. Sometimes the smallest things can mean the world.

Outside of your gender equality advocacy work, what do you enjoy doing?

I enjoy playing basketball, table tennis, and Rubik’s cube. I love making 2D Animation and cartooning as well.
